Empire Recap: Sinned Against

November 27, 2015 by tamaratattles 7 Comments

Empire top shot

 

Guest Recap by Glow

I hope everyone had a great Thanksgiving.  With preparations for Thanksgiving, cooking, and family time I didn’t watch this episode of Empire until today after sleeping half the day away.  I continue to run hot and cold with this show but this episode has me excited about what’s to come.

We again have celebrity guests.  Alicia Keyes and Rosie O’Donnell.  Alicia, of course, plays a recording star named Skye Summer and Rosie’s character is Cookie’s former prison mate who now works as a baker.  There is also the added bonus of Lee Daniels, the show’s Creator and Executive Producer, who plays himself.

Cookie

We pick up with Cookie and her sister Candace (Vivica A. Fox) in Philly searching for missing sister, Carol, who has left her kids with Candace and is off on a bender. While walking the streets looking for Carol we get to see the relationship dynamic between Cookie and Candace.  Cookie’s hair, long and sleek with an off center part, is fabulous.  I wonder if it’s from Porsha’s Go Naked Hair line. Cookie’s big red fur coat is not my favorite but I digress. The interaction of the bougie sister and the ex-con, streetwise sister is entertaining and often funny. They eventually find Carol with help of Cookie’s ex prison mate. Carol, looks like crap and responds to demands to get in the car by throwing up on Candace’s shoes. After being confronted by her sisters Carol is left with decision to come home with either of them.  Carol opts to leave her kids with Carol and go home with Cookie, whose real name is Lorethia and the name Candace calls her.  Candace is clearly not a favorite of either sister. We do learn that Carol did something while Cookie was in prison that would not make Cookie happy.

Empire 1

This whole thing with Carol is connected to their cousin, Jamil, whose head was sent to Cookie in a box a while back and all of that leads back to Lucious. Candace questions Cookie about this and Cookies plays it off. There is a lot of conflict between the sisters that goes back to childhood. Eventually, Cookie talks to Carol about the Jamil thing and tells Carol she needs help.  She needs to go to rehab.

Back in New York, Cookie has to deal with Lucious who asks her to sign over her rights to his early songs. He explains he has an opportunity to raise the capital to buy Swift Stream.  His he for real?  Why would she do that? Would he do it for her?  Lucious tries hard to convince Cookie but she’s not having it.  Laz walks in and gets introduced to Lucious and then walks over to Cookie and they kiss.  Lucious: It’s nice to see you sleeping your way to the bottom.”  I can see the wheels turning in Lucious’ head.  Looks Like Laz is rubbing everyone the wrong way.

Cookie is with Hakeem and Laz in her office.  Laz is trying to convince Cookie to change the venue for the Cookout event.  He’s trying to sever ties with Big Heavy. Cookie will not consider it. Laz is asking Cookie to trust him when Lucious walks in informing everyone he couldn’t get Laz off his mind so he did some digging. He tells Laz he’s one of those Bully Boys.  Laz is caught.  Lucious shares that the 125th Street Bulls run a petty scam “extorting young rappers and making their mommas pay for it.”  Hakeem says the snatchers had a bull on their backs and asks if Laz has one.  Cookie’s light comes on.  She walks to Laz, takes his gun out of the back of his pants, pulls his shirt to expose the bull and ask “Like this? It’s the end of this road for Laz and all he can do is say when he started this it was just a game.  He didn’t know he was going to fall in love with Cookie. Cookie gives the gun to Lucious and leaves with Hakeem.  The look in her eyes. Poor Laz.  How will this play out?

Hakeem

With Cookie away in Philly, Hakeem is left to keep things going with Lyon Dynasty and the Cookout event.  During a phone conversation with his mother he tells her the Cookout sold out and Rock Steady Park wants them to do another show.  Cookie loves this and tells him to get Laz to book a second show and to make sure his girl group is ready. Hakeem is yet to realize he has another major issue to contend with.  Anika apparently just drove Laura home last week because there is with Hakeem periscoping a performance while Anika is at home in a room filled with clippings and photos of Hakeem and Hakeem with Laura. Everything about this tells me there is about to be another bout of the crazies.

Laz is at Lyon Dynasty when Big Heavy and the crew show up. They want money and Laz tells Heavy it’s not time to get paid yet. Laz and Heavy are in convict. They don’t see things the same way. Heavy wants to hit Cookie and Jamal harder but Laz calls the deal off and pulls a gun on Heavy.  Looks like Laz is headed for hard times.  Hakeem talks with Laz about why Big Heavy was at his studio and Laz advises Hakeem he took care of it. Hakeem ask Laz why he’s stalling on announcing the second concert.  Laz tells Hakeem he’s not stalling and to trust him.  Hakeem says ok but don’t let him down.  They seem to be in a better place.

Anika shows up at one of Hakeem’s always in session parties. She immediately starts to go in on Laura. Laura seems to recognize Anika and ask if she knows her from somewhere.  After some petty bitchiness that includes implying Laura is not a real singer, telling Hakeem Laura lives with seven siblings and he could do so much better Anika leaves.

Anika meets with Rhonda again. This time at the mansion Lucious just purchased for her and Andre.  Anika seems a little off so Rhonda ask her if she ok.  She gives some story about being in love with someone Rhonda doesn’t know.  A musician. They share some girl talk about being in love and having another woman lust for your man.  Rhonda tells Anika sometimes you have fight for someone you care about and take down anyone who gets in your way.  Does she realize she just gave this advice to an unstable woman who is already stalking another woman?

Later Hakeem invites Anika to his place and she comes in like a tornado.  She tells Hakeem he is not being honest about their relationship, she knows he loves her, he comes to her every time he’s in need. Hakeem denies he’s in love with her and tells her she will never be a Lyon.

Empire 2

Jamal

Jamal’s focus is preparing to shoot his Pepsi commercial and working on his upcoming Black & White album. At a press conference Lucious makes the announcement that Skye Summers will be performing on Jamal’s album.  Skye is an artist with another label but wants to work with Jamal and Lucious.  During the photo op Lucious takes time to tell Jamal he thinks the commercial should be about the young prince paying homage to his father.  In other words, it should be about Lucious. Jamal is gushing. Is he crushing on Skye?  Skye is not feeling the press conference and wants to leave to go to the studio.

Jamal hears Skye sing a song that she says her label won’t let her release.  Skye is boxed into a certain image but wants to expand and be edgier. Jamal wants to help her break out of that box. Later at Jamal’s place Skye and Jamal sing the completed song they worked on together.  It’s a beautiful song and a sweet moment that ends with Jamal wrapping his arms around Skye while she sits at the piano.  Then it happens.  Their eyes lock. They Kiss.  This was the last scene and I must admit it left me near breathless.

Lucious

Lucious is being Lucious. Conniving, dirty, desperate.  He has bought a mansion for Andre and Rhonda.  He is apparently all into Rhonda being pregnant and being assured the empire will continue.  As a side note, Rhonda met with a pregnant Anika last episode and shared with her that Lucious was a sucker for babies.  This pregnancy seems to mean a lot to Lucious and he beaming, rubbing Rhonda’s tummy, and telling Andre he is no longer being tested. Andre is so grateful.  Immediately after hugging it out, Lucious tells Andre he wants them to move faster on the Swift Steam deal. Lucious wants Empire to be the dominant force in music streaming. Andre has a solution that involves Lucious’ old songs so there’s a catch…Cookie still owns half the publishing rights to some of Lucious’ old songs.

Lucious and Jamal are entertaining her Skye and her manager when Lucious asks Jamal to play a song for them.  You can tell by Skye’s face she’s not exactly feeling it.  She was hoping for something edgier. Lucious advises Skye everyone has a lane and her lane is Girl Power Pop. Everyone should stay in their lane lest they crash and burn. Jamal gets Lucious and the manager to leave to the room so he can talk to Skye.  Skye apparently doesn’t agree with the box her label has her in. She and Jamal decided to write something together more suited to her taste.

Meeting with Hakeem, Lucious tries to convince Hakeem to sign with Empire telling him if he signs and post video saying his keeping the last name Lyon Lucious will make him a full partner with his brothers in Swift Stream. Hakeem questions how he can trust his father and Lucious tells him to talk to Andre, that he just bought Andre a mansion in Long Island. Lucious: What do you want?” Hakeem: “This son can’t be bought.”

At Jamal’s Pepsi commercial shoot Lucious ask Lee Daniels, who he’s hired to direct the shoot, if he’s talked to Jamal about Lucious’ father/son idea for the commercial.  Lee advises Lucious he’s decided to do something different. “Lucious, you represent the past. This kid, he’s the future.” Someone else has pissed Lucious off by not seeing his greatness. This means another person he has to shoot back at. Lucious is wearing me out. They watch Jamal perform with Lucious seething the entire time.   Lucious tells Andre to do whatever needs to be done to buy Swift Steam.  He does his Lucious rant about what it takes to be great ending with “Lee Daniels thinks he’s seen the future, I’m a show him.”

This episode was full of cliffhangers and I am left excited to see how things turn out with Laz, Anika, and Jamal.  One thing I am sure of. Lucious will stirring many pots and can’t wait to see what he cooks up.
